Summary

The Camera Hardware Engineering group is responsible for all research, design, development, testing, and qualification of camera hardware for Apple products. We are seeking for an extraordinary individual to help us tackle tomorrow's challenges! You will collaborate with teams across Apple to explore, define, and drive the development of next-generation cameras.

As a Camera Module Characterization Engineer, you will design laboratory experiments, develop metrology tools and platforms, and create image processing algorithms to evaluate camera actuator technologies and camera designs. You will take ownership of performance characterization, design validation, and failure analysis.

BS degree in Physics, ME, EE, or Optical Engineering, with a minimum 3+ years of relevant industry experience\nExperience with Matlab or Python programming skills\nExperience in at least 1 of the following domains: Optical imaging system test and image quality analysis, CMOS image sensor validation, VCM actuator and position sensor calibration/test, image processing and quantitative image analysis

MS/PhD in Physics, ME, EE, or Optical Engineering\nExperience with camera image quality metrics and evaluation methodologies\nExperience with image processing and camera ISP pipelines\nExperience with development of characterization setups involving cameras, lasers, temperature control, custom mechanical and electrical hardware\nExperience with design and validation of control systems and optical/magnetic sensing systems\nExperience with camera lens evaluation and CMOS image sensors technology\nExperience supporting volume manufacturing of camera systems at supplier sites
